blackout
/blæk,aʊt/
noun
8 letters2 syllables16 points in Scrabble®20 points in WWF®
DEFINITIONS5
NOUN
1
Partial or total loss of memory.
“he has a total blackout for events of the evening”
2
Darkness resulting from the extinction of lights (as in a city invisible to enemy aircraft).
3
A momentary loss of consciousness.
4
A suspension of radio or tv broadcasting.
5
The failure of electric power for a general region.
